fix: append .exe suffix to Windows binary download filename

The drone-ssh release publishes Windows assets with an .exe suffix
(e.g. drone-ssh-1.8.2-windows-amd64.exe), but entrypoint.sh built the
download filename without it, so every Windows runner failed with a 404
at the download step (ERR_DOWNLOAD_FAILED).

Append .exe when the detected platform is windows. This also keeps the
checksums.txt lookup working on Windows since entries match the exact
asset name. Add a windows-latest CI job that exercises the download,
checksum verification, and binary execution path.

Fixes #417

@ -39,6 +39,10 @@ function detect_client_info() {
detect_client_info
DOWNLOAD_URL_PREFIX="${DRONE_SSH_RELEASE_URL}/v${DRONE_SSH_VERSION}"
CLIENT_BINARY="drone-ssh-${DRONE_SSH_VERSION}-${CLIENT_PLATFORM}-${CLIENT_ARCH}"
# Windows release assets are published with an .exe suffix
if [[ "${CLIENT_PLATFORM}" == "windows" ]]; then
CLIENT_BINARY="${CLIENT_BINARY}.exe"
fi
TARGET="${GITHUB_ACTION_PATH}/${CLIENT_BINARY}"
